H.R. 3317 House Government Operations and Politics

Honoring Civil Servants Killed in the Line of Duty Act

Introduced
May 9, 2025
Sponsor
Rep. Connolly, Gerald E. (D-VA-11)

  1. House Introduced in House May 9, 2025
  2. House Referred to the Committee on Oversight and Government Reform, and in addition to the Committees on Foreign Affairs, Armed Services, Veterans' Affairs, Transportation and Infrastructure, Homeland Security, and Ways and Means, for a period to be subsequently determined by the Speaker, in each case for consideration of such provisions as fall within the jurisdiction of the committee concerned. May 9, 2025
  3. House Referred to the Subcommittee on Transportation and Maritime Security. May 12, 2025
  4. House ASSUMING FIRST SPONSORSHIP - Mr. Walkinshaw asked unanimous consent that he may hereafter be considered as the first sponsor of H.R. 3317, a bill originally introduced by Representative Connolly, for the purpose of adding cosponsors and requesting reprintings pursuant to clause 7 of rule XII. Agreed to without objection. Apr 27, 2026
